【技术实现步骤摘要】
地图的渲染方法、装置、计算机设备和存储介质
本申请涉及计算机
,尤其涉及一种地图的渲染方法、装置、计算机设备和存储介质。
技术介绍
随着视觉媒体技术的发展,三维地图的展示方式越来越多样化。特别在车辆导航应用领域,人们不仅需要获取三维导航地图上的车道区域信息,还需要获取三维导航地图上的非车道区域信息,以便车辆在地图指示的地理位置上正常行驶。目前,在对三维导航地图进行渲染时,通常会将三维导航地图上的车道区域信息进行渲染,例如,车道线、车道线上的导航点、车道线所在的车道区域等,以便之后绘制地图时,车道区域信息可以明显的标记在三维导航地图上,方便车辆用户行驶在车道区域上时使用。但是,在现有的三维导航地图的渲染方法中,没有实现对非车道区域的渲染,导致难以将非车道区域在三维地图上标记出来,降低了三维导航地图的展示多样性。
技术实现思路
基于此,有必要针对上述技术问题,提供一种渲染非车道区域的地图的渲染方法、装置、计算机设备和存储介质。第一方面,一种地图的渲染方法,所述方法包括:根 ...
【技术保护点】
1.一种地图的渲染方法,其特征在于,所述方法包括:/n根据目标地图的点坐标,获取与所述目标地图对应的初始二维矩阵;所述初始二维矩阵的所有元素的值均相同;/n根据所述目标地图中各坐标点的类型,将所述初始二维矩阵中不同类型的坐标点对应的元素设置为不同的值,得到目标二维矩阵;/n根据所述目标二维矩阵,生成表示第一区域的多边形区域;/n根据所述第一区域的多边形区域,渲染所述目标地图上的第一区域。/n
【技术特征摘要】
1.一种地图的渲染方法,其特征在于,所述方法包括:
根据目标地图的点坐标,获取与所述目标地图对应的初始二维矩阵;所述初始二维矩阵的所有元素的值均相同;
根据所述目标地图中各坐标点的类型,将所述初始二维矩阵中不同类型的坐标点对应的元素设置为不同的值,得到目标二维矩阵;
根据所述目标二维矩阵,生成表示第一区域的多边形区域;
根据所述第一区域的多边形区域,渲染所述目标地图上的第一区域。
2.根据权利要求1所述的方法,其特征在于,若所述初始二维矩阵的所有元素的值均为第一值,以及所述目标地图中各坐标点的类型为第二区域的坐标点时,则根据所述目标地图中各坐标点的类型,将所述初始二维矩阵中不同类型的坐标点对应的元素设置为不同的值,得到目标二维矩阵,包括:
将所述初始二维矩阵中与所述第二区域的坐标点对应的元素设置为第二值,得到所述目标二维矩阵。
3.根据权利要求1或2所述的方法,其特征在于,若所述初始二维矩阵的所有元素的值均为第一值,以及所述目标地图中各坐标点的类型为所述第一区域的坐标点时,所述第一区域的坐标点包括:第一区域线上的坐标点和导航点的坐标点。
4.根据权利要求3所述的方法,其特征在于,所述根据所述目标地图中各坐标点的类型,将所述初始二维矩阵中不同类型的坐标点对应的元素设置为不同的值,得到目标二维矩阵,包括:
根据所述目标地图中各坐标点的类型,确定所述初始二维矩阵中第一区域线上的坐标点对应的元素和导航点的坐标点对应的元素;
对所述第一区域线上的坐标点对应的元素和所述导航点的坐标点对应的元素分别设置不同的值,得到所述目标二维矩阵。
5.根据权利要求4所述的方法,其特征在于,所述根据所述目标地图中各坐标点的类型,将所述初始二维矩阵中不同类型的坐标点对应的元素设置为不同的值,得到目标二维矩阵,包括:
将所述初始二维矩阵中与所述第一区域线上的坐标点对应的元素设置为第三值,得到第一中间二维矩阵;
将所述第一中间二维矩阵中与所述导航点的坐标点对应的元素设置为第四值,得到第二中间二维矩阵;
将所述第二中间二维矩阵中与所述导航点的坐标点连...
【专利技术属性】
技术研发人员:区彦开,潘超,韩旭,
申请(专利权)人:广州文远知行科技有限公司,
类型:发明
国别省市:广东;44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。